WebA Year, in its simplest form, is the amount of time that it takes for the earth to revolve once around the sun. Specifically, a year is three-hundred-sixty-five days, six hours, nine minutes, and 9.54 seconds. Therefore, a year is not exactly three-hundred-sixty-five days nor is it quite three-hundred-sixty-six.

That’s a … WebAug 16, 2024 · Much Classical music is grouped in twos or threes. Each group is known as a “measure” or “bar” and in notation is separated by a “barline." The meter is indicated by a “time signature,” such as 3/4. The top number shows the number of beats in the measure, while the lower number shows the value assigned to each beat.
